Accountable for leading the incubation of new architecture capabilities at the data center level, turning emerging technologies and architectural concepts into proven, repeatable capabilities that can scale across the enterprise. Leads a team of architects through discovery, experimentation, proof-of-concept development, technical validation, and transition to operational ownership. Establishes clear guardrails, success measures, reference patterns, and adoption pathways so that new infrastructure, platform, data, integration, automation, security, and observability capabilities can be evaluated safely and advanced based on evidence. Partners with data center engineering, infrastructure, security, operations, product, and enterprise architecture leaders to prioritize incubation opportunities, remove barriers, and align experiments with business outcomes, enterprise standards, and long-term technology strategy. Builds an environment that encourages disciplined innovation, rapid learning, technical excellence, and responsible handoff from incubation into production-ready service capabilities. Lead with a focus on disciplined innovation and empowered teams. Coach and mentor architects as they explore new capabilities, develop hypotheses, design experiments, interpret results, and communicate recommendations. Build a culture that balances speed of learning with security, reliability, compliance, and operational accountability. Align staffing, vendor support, laboratory capacity, and funding with the highest-value incubation priorities. b. Build and govern a data center architecture incubation practice. Establish a transparent intake and prioritization process for new capability ideas. Define stage gates from discovery through proof-of-concept, pilot, production readiness, and operational handoff. Ensure each incubation effort has a clear problem statement, sponsor, scope, assumptions, success measures, risks, decision rights, and exit criteria. c. Make the data center a proving ground for future-ready architecture capabilities. Guide the evaluation of emerging infrastructure, hybrid cloud, platform, network, storage, compute, automation, observability, resilience, security, data, and integration approaches. Ensure experiments are isolated appropriately, aligned with enterprise standards, and designed to generate reusable learning rather than one-off demonstrations. d. Convert validated learning into reusable architecture assets. Oversee the development of reference architectures, capability models, patterns, standards, guardrails, decision records, test results, implementation guidance, and operational readiness criteria. Ensure artifacts clearly describe where a capability fits, when to use it, known constraints, dependencies, cost implications, and the path to broader adoption. e. Create a reliable transition from incubation to enterprise capability. Partner with engineering, infrastructure, cybersecurity, operations, service management, product, and business leaders to define ownership, funding, support models, skills, controls, migration approaches, and adoption plans. Prevent successful pilots from stalling by establishing handoff expectations early and confirming production readiness before scale-out. f. Incubate modern data and integration capabilities at the platform level. Evaluate API-first architectures, event-driven integration, scalable data platforms, AI/ML enablement, and self-service access patterns in the context of data center and hybrid environments. Validate data integrity, security, performance, resilience, interoperability, observability, and operational support before recommending enterprise adoption. g. Maintain an active pipeline of architecture experiments. Scout relevant technology trends, frame opportunities against enterprise needs, and run focused proof-of-concepts that answer specific technical and business questions. Use evidence from experiments to recommend investment, refinement, standardization, or retirement. Share outcomes broadly so that both successful and unsuccessful experiments accelerate organizational learning. h. Manage architecture incubation resources and outcomes. Balance architects and enabling engineering resources across experiments, contribute to strategic planning and budgeting, manage vendor participation, and prioritize investments based on potential value, risk reduction, feasibility, and readiness. Report the incubation portfolio, decisions, learning, risks, and transition status to technology leadership. i. Other duties as assigned.
